I was browsing the GC used site, and came across a decent price on some monitors (kali lp6's) then upon looking a little more, I noticed MF had two of the white ones for $139/each (normally $199) and with the free shipping, that was only a few dollars more than the used pair. I decided to think on it for a day or two, and then got an offer for 15% off an order of $250+ So I went ahead and ordered the pair of monitors, which came to right at $250/pair brand new.

A few days later, I get an e-mail saying one of the two had been cancelled. I call the following day asking to cancel the other one, and that guy on the phone all but refuses to let me cancel my order. He keeps offering to find me some alternative speakers, or sell me another lp6 in a different color. I told him, if I can't get a matching pair for the price I paid, to just cancel altogether.

He then tells me that a guitar center store is already processing the order, and that I would have to contact them directly to cancel it. I voiced that it doesn't make sense that I would have to contact a 3rd party, that should be their job to handle it. I finally ask him for the location and contact info for the GC I'm allegedly supposed to contact, and he puts me on hold for another 10 minutes, eventually telling me that his supervisor was able to get my order canceled :rolleyes:

I haven't bought anything from them in years except the occasional cheapo items like strings or headphones when they're on sale. I should have known better.
